Spondylolisthesis of the axis vertebra [PDF]

open access: yesAmerican Journal of Roentgenology, 1977
The second cervical vertebra, or axis, is readily distinguished from all others by a toothlike projection from the upper end of the body, the dens (fig. 1 ). Anteriorly the dens has a facet for articulation with the corresponding facet on the innermost surface of the anterior arch of the atlas.

Polarization Sensitivity of Chiral Manganese Halide Scintillators Enables High‐Resolution X‐Ray Imaging

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Highly luminescent chiral manganese halide crystals are synthesized using chiral ligands, and they exhibit dissymmetry factors up to 1.4 × 10−2 and show X‐ray detection scintillation capability with a light yield of 43 380 photons/MeV and a low detection limit of 0.05198 µGyair·s−1.
